Macrophage activation by endogenous danger signals.
1Department of Cell Biology and Molecular Genetics, University of Maryland, College Park, MD 20742, USA.
Macrophages are key immune cells that initiate, propagate, and resolve inflammation. This review details how macrophages respond to both external microbial signals and internal danger signals, influencing autoimmune diseases.
Area of Science:
- Immunology
- Cell Biology
Background:
- Macrophages are crucial immune cells acting as the first line of defense.
- They activate in response to exogenous pathogen-associated molecular patterns (PAMPs) and endogenous danger signals from damaged self-cells.
- Macrophage activation is central to both the initiation and resolution of inflammation.
Purpose of the Study:
- To review the multifaceted role of macrophages in inflammation.
- To highlight the impact of endogenous danger signals on macrophage activation.
- To examine the molecular mechanisms and disease implications of macrophage dysregulation.
Main Methods:
- Literature review of macrophage activation and inflammatory responses.
- Analysis of molecular signaling pathways triggered by exogenous and endogenous stimuli.
- Examination of the link between macrophage activation and autoimmune pathologies.
Main Results:
- Macrophage activation by PAMPs and endogenous danger signals shares common pathways.
- Endogenous danger signals can enhance inflammation, potentially contributing to autoimmune diseases.
- Macrophages are involved in initiating, propagating, and resolving inflammatory responses.
Conclusions:
- Macrophages play a pivotal role throughout the inflammatory process.
- Understanding macrophage responses to endogenous danger signals is critical for managing inflammation and autoimmune conditions.
- Dysregulated macrophage activation contributes to various diseases.
